A Pinch of Magic is a single player action game. It was developed by Crystal Game Works and was released on April 16, 2021. It received positive reviews from players.

Varsha is a young witch who has just graduated high school. While their friends were off jet setting and travelling around the world, Varsha had to go back to their hometown Lynnsdale to take care of their grandparents who ran a small magic store.   • The game features a cute art style and charming characters, making it visually appealing.
  • It's a free-to-play visual novel that offers a relaxing experience with LGBTQ+ friendly content.
  • The story, while short, is engaging and allows for character customization, including pronoun choices.
  • Kiana's route is significantly shorter and less developed compared to Mikhail's, leading to a feeling of imbalance in the storytelling.
  • The gameplay lacks depth, with minimal choices and interactions, making it feel more like an e-book than a game.
  • Some players found the writing to be mediocre, with issues in pacing and character development.

    The game's story is generally described as cute and enjoyable, with charming art and a light-hearted romantic theme, but many reviewers feel it is too short and lacks depth. While one character's route is more developed than the other, leading to an uneven experience, there is a consensus that the narrative could benefit from more choices, endings, and character development. Overall, players appreciate the potential of the story but express a desire for a more fleshed-out and engaging plot.

    The music in the game receives mixed reviews, with some players appreciating its calming and pleasant ambiance that complements the visuals and story, while others find it repetitive and distracting. The soundtrack features a blend of eighties synth pop and piano tracks, but some transitions between songs are noted as jarring. Overall, while many enjoy the music's vibe, there are calls for improvement to better align it with the game's emotional tone.
